From: Plainville, CT Dear TaxMama Can Non Residents (NR - Resident of India) file their Taxes electronically? Suggest any websites that allows filing of tax returns online? Lakshmikanth ![]() You are presently living in the US. So there should be no problem filing your taxes electronically. While I wouldn't normally recommend sites online for tax preparation .... for a whole bunch of quality, competence and security issues .... (and I have turned down 3 or 4 vendors that begged for TaxMama recommendations) at least TurboTax Online ought to be fine - if not, they certainly have enough assets so you could sue the company of there is a problem. But, if are not familiar with US tax laws, really, it might be more advantageous to meet with a local tax professional. I certainly wouldn't go to India and try to prepare my own tax reports there! Even Isaac Asimov, who was quite a genius, preferred to have a tax professional handle his tax affairs. He felt there was too much to constantly learn to do it all himself. And you think you can just walk in and do it yourself? Good luck and Best wishes Eva Rosenberg TaxMama |
